Re: [w3c/editing] Seeking feedback on delayed clipboard rendering proposal (Issue #417)

Details from 2023-01-12 call:

[torsdag 12 januari 2023] [17:04:49 CET] <smaug> topic: [https://github.com/w3c/editing/issues/417](https://nam06.safelinks.protection.outlook.com/?url=https%3A%2F%2Fgithub.com%2Fw3c%2Fediting%2Fissues%2F417&data=05%7C01%7Csajos%40microsoft.com%7Cf5ea88b0ce2b4b1febcb08db0ab2e61b%7C72f988bf86f141af91ab2d7cd011db47%7C1%7C0%7C638115535729361091%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C3000%7C%7C%7C&sdata=oV6tuFiD0wyUegogpaAfxbRoU%2BHyF51s1MRVTOkxrcs%3D&reserved=0)
[torsdag 12 januari 2023] [17:04:49 CET] * github-bot Because I don't want to spam github issues unnecessarily, I won't comment in that github issue unless you write "Github: <issue-url> | none" (or "Github issue: ..."/"Github topic: ...").
[torsdag 12 januari 2023] [17:06:07 CET] <sanketj> Link to Delayed Clipboard Rendering explainer: [https://github.com/MicrosoftEdge/MSEdgeExplainers/blob/main/DelayedClipboard/DelayedClipboardRenderingExplainer.md](https://nam06.safelinks.protection.outlook.com/?url=https%3A%2F%2Fgithub.com%2FMicrosoftEdge%2FMSEdgeExplainers%2Fblob%2Fmain%2FDelayedClipboard%2FDelayedClipboardRenderingExplainer.md&data=05%7C01%7Csajos%40microsoft.com%7Cf5ea88b0ce2b4b1febcb08db0ab2e61b%7C72f988bf86f141af91ab2d7cd011db47%7C1%7C0%7C638115535729361091%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C3000%7C%7C%7C&sdata=snXbYFGpsrnP8SHtaU1I2IKjbKASJOSejRPSkKtvSJE%3D&reserved=0)
[torsdag 12 januari 2023] [17:07:59 CET] <smaug> ana: goal is to improve performance. Going through the proposed solution
[torsdag 12 januari 2023] [17:09:31 CET] <whsieh> q+
[torsdag 12 januari 2023] [17:10:56 CET] <smaug> whsieh: wondering if the the spec already fulfills the use case
[torsdag 12 januari 2023] [17:11:37 CET] <smaug> anypam: we want to wait until the target app needs the data
[torsdag 12 januari 2023] [17:11:38 CET] Join AlexK ([~AlexK@d9560e24.public.cloak](mailto:~AlexK@d9560e24.public.cloak)) has joined this channel.
[torsdag 12 januari 2023] [17:12:18 CET] <whsieh> [https://www.w3.org/TR/clipboard-apis/](https://nam06.safelinks.protection.outlook.com/?url=https%3A%2F%2Fwww.w3.org%2FTR%2Fclipboard-apis%2F&data=05%7C01%7Csajos%40microsoft.com%7Cf5ea88b0ce2b4b1febcb08db0ab2e61b%7C72f988bf86f141af91ab2d7cd011db47%7C1%7C0%7C638115535729517310%7CUnknown%7CTWFpbGZsb3d8eyJWIjoiMC4wLjAwMDAiLCJQIjoiV2luMzIiLCJBTiI6Ik1haWwiLCJXVCI6Mn0%3D%7C3000%7C%7C%7C&sdata=5CfX1W%2Fiha3whWofT2x3%2B15HEGjr3rFtXxbhGFABrec%3D&reserved=0)
[torsdag 12 januari 2023] [17:12:30 CET] <whsieh> typedef Promise<ClipboardItemDataType> ClipboardItemData;
[torsdag 12 januari 2023] [17:13:35 CET] <smaug> whsieh: UA could only call the promise when data is needed
[torsdag 12 januari 2023] [17:16:54 CET] <smaug> sanket: wondering is there are limitations with resolving the promise with a blob
[torsdag 12 januari 2023] [17:18:36 CET] <snianu> we can discuss more about promise vs callback in the issue async. Need some time to think through what all cases might not work with the promise approach.
[torsdag 12 januari 2023] [17:19:34 CET] <smaug> johanneswilm: how does the proposal work if the browser closes
[torsdag 12 januari 2023] [17:19:44 CET] <johanneswilm> or native app
[torsdag 12 januari 2023] [17:21:31 CET] <smaug> smaug: could also consider some generic API for async Blobs or such
[torsdag 12 januari 2023] [17:21:50 CET] <smaug> sanket: are there any concerns about the concept?
[torsdag 12 januari 2023] [17:21:58 CET] <smaug> whsieh: no concerns
[torsdag 12 januari 2023] [17:22:10 CET] <smaug> smaug: no concerns
[torsdag 12 januari 2023] [17:22:48 CET] <smaug> whsieh: would it be left up to UA whether to do delayed rendering?
[torsdag 12 januari 2023] [17:23:14 CET] <smaug> sanket: should probably be MAY in the spec
[torsdag 12 januari 2023] [17:24:28 CET] <smaug> ACTION: everyone to take a look at the existing API and check if it can be used for the delayed rendering use case.

-- 
Reply to this email directly or view it on GitHub:
https://github.com/w3c/editing/issues/417#issuecomment-1452770119
You are receiving this because you are subscribed to this thread.

Message ID: <w3c/editing/issues/417/1452770119@github.com>

Received on Friday, 3 March 2023 00:37:46 UTC